| The hatchback generally has more luggage space thanks to a larger trunk door opening and the ability to convert the rear of the passenger compartment into luggage space. Sedans tend to be quieter than hatchbacks, due to a more isolated rear area. | |||

| Camshaft drive: | Timing belt | Timing chain | |
| Timing belt usually needs to be replaced more often than the chain, but it is usually significantly cheaper. Timing belt motors are generally quieter and less vibrating than chain motors. | |||

Fuel consumption | |||
| Fuel consumption (l/100km): | 4.9 | 5.7 | |
| Real fuel consumption: | 6.7 l/100km | 6.9 l/100km | |
|
The Audi A3 is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y. By specification Audi A3 consumes 0.8 litres less fuel per 100 km than the BMW 1 series, which means that by driving the Audi A3 over 15,000 km in a year you can save 120 litres of fuel. By comparing actual fuel consumption based on user reports, Audi A3 consumes 0.2 litres less fuel per 100 km than the BMW 1 series. | |||
